WebNov 26, 2016 · Once you have that identified it's pretty simple. White from the switch connects to the two blacks that aren't in the same cable as that white. The other whites get bundled with each other and the fixture white. Black that pairs with the switch white connects to the fixture black. Fixture ground gets ignored if there's no ground at the … WebWire with Polyethylene Outer Insulation: -40° to 190° F Install this wire in conduit and cable trays in commercial and industrial buildings. If it trips the breaker right away (within a second or so) then you have a "dead short", which means one of the hot wires is touching a neutral wire or something else that's grounded. You will have to go through to double- and triple-check that the wiring is done properly and there are no stray hot wires. WebJun 15, 2024 · Check Your Wiring Before You Buy the Light Fixture Replacement. If your home was built before 1985, beware: Many new light fixtures can’t be connected to pre-1985 wiring because the insulation on the wiring can’t withstand the heat generated by the fixture.
